Subject: [PATCH v2 1/3] doc: tag: document `TAG_EDITMSG`
Date: Mon, 15 May 2023 22:29:33 +0200	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<0e0e592853d272a28fb04c5183784339d7377547.1684181855.git.code@khaugsbakk.name>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<cover.1684181855.git.code@khaugsbakk.name>

Document `TAG_EDITMSG` which we have told the user about on unsuccessful
command invocations since commit 3927bbe9a4 (tag: delete TAG_EDITMSG
only on successful tag, 2008-12-06).

Introduce this documentation since we are going to add tests for the
lifetime of this file in the case of command failure and success.

Use the documentation for `COMMIT_EDITMSG` from `git-commit.txt` as a
template since these two files share the same purpose.[1]

† 1: from commit 3927bbe9a4:

     “ This matches the behavior of COMMIT_EDITMSG, which stays around
       in case of error.

diff --git a/Documentation/git-tag.txt b/Documentation/git-tag.txt
index fdc72b5875..46e56b0245 100644
--- a/Documentation/git-tag.txt
+++ b/Documentation/git-tag.txt
@@ -377,6 +377,16 @@ $ GIT_COMMITTER_DATE="2006-10-02 10:31" git tag -s v1.0.1
 
 include::date-formats.txt[]
 
+FILES
+-----
+
+`$GIT_DIR/TAG_EDITMSG`::
+	This file contains the message of an in-progress annotated
+	tag. If `git tag` exits due to an error before creating an
+	annotated tag then the tag message that has been provided by the
+	user in an editor session will be available in this file, but
+	may be overwritten by the next invocation of `git tag`.
+
 NOTES
 -----
